Assessments

Online mental health assessments are an excellent way to determine if you suffer from a mental illness and to discover treatments. These tools are simple to use and can help determine whether your symptoms are related to a medical condition that is treatable such as depression or anxiety. These tests will ask you questions about your symptoms and how they affect you and your family background. Being honest in answering these questions is very important. The more precise your answers, the better chance you have of getting a correct diagnosis. It is also important to discuss any medication that you are taking or have taken in the past. Some drugs can have an effect on your mood or thoughts It is therefore important to inform your doctor of the complete picture of your health.

A thorough online psychological evaluation can be conducted in just a few minutes. It's a great alternative to traditional face-to-face psychological assessments, which can be costly and time-consuming. These online assessment tools can be used to check for anxiety, depression and other disorders and aid you in making an informed choice about the best course of action for your specific situation.

These assessments enable therapists to monitor the progress of their clients and keep track of their wellbeing. These information is crucial to their practice and can assist them in developing specific interventions and increase engagement with clients. These assessments are also available in digital format, which facilitates regular data collection and can reduce the chance of errors. Additionally, these assessments can be integrated into existing systems, like electronic health record (EHR) systems and practice management software.

When selecting an online mental health assessment tool make sure that it has been through rigorous testing and validation. These tests involve comparing the results of the tool with established standards for clinical practice and other validated measures. This ensures that the tool accurately evaluates its claims and is not prone to bias. Be sure that the tool is accessible across different platforms and devices including tablets, smartphones computers, and other mobile devices.

Despite the growing acceptance of these tests there are some limitations. They might not be able to precisely identify a mental disorder or predict when someone might seek help. They also do not reflect the experiences of everyone. There is also a risk of a misdiagnosis or excessive treatment.

Reports

Clinicians use psychiatric assessment instruments to identify symptoms and determine the root causes of mental disorders. They usually consist of questionnaires and interviews that assess the severity, presence of symptoms, frequency, and duration of a broad range of symptoms. However they are typically built around a specific classification system and restrict their use to the most obvious symptoms of an illness. This can result in inconsistencies regarding diagnosis and hamper studies into the underlying causes of psychiatric disorders.

Assessment tools online have transformed the landscape of psychiatric diagnosis and assessment. These tools are designed to gather information and provide a summary of the user's findings in just a few minutes. They can also connect the user to a local high-quality treatment provider. They can also help the patient to track their progress and keep track of changes in symptoms.

While self-assessments online can be a great way to recognize certain signs, they cannot replace the need for an extensive evaluation by an experienced mental health professional. In fact, they can result in a misdiagnosis since the results of these tests may be misleading if they are not interpreted in conjunction with other factors that influence the diagnosis, such as the patient's past and life experiences.

The use of various assessment tools by different clinicians can cause confusion in the diagnosis, since the instruments are usually limited to a limited set of symptoms and do not cover the entirety of an illness's presentation. This is especially important in the case of the atypical manifestations of mental illnesses, which are more common in the elderly and often exhibit a pattern of symptoms that overlap with other illnesses.

Fortunately technology is helping reduce the barriers to mental health care and making it accessible to more people than ever before. Digital assessment tools are expanding rapidly as more clinicians are recognizing the potential of these innovative and powerful tools to improve access to psychiatric services for patients. Digital tools are also more efficient, convenient, and cost-effective, and offer greater data collection capacity. They also reduce the time required for clinical assessments.

Treatment options

Online mental health assessments help to identify mental health issues that could be causing problems. These tests give results to the user that they can communicate with their therapist, or psychiatrist, and provide suggestions for treatment options. They also provide the names of local, high-quality healthcare providers. It is crucial to remember that online tests are just one piece of the puzzle. The most important factor for success is ongoing therapy and support from friends and family.

The most popular methods of treating mental illness are psychotherapy and psychiatric medications. These treatments can be utilized either in conjunction or as a stand-alone. Psychotherapy, also referred to as talk therapy, helps those who suffer from a variety of problems, including depression and anxiety. These treatments may be individual in that the person is the only person in the room with a therapist, or they can be group therapy. Group therapy is a regular gathering of a small group of patients to discuss their issues. It can be helpful to learn that other patients have the same problems and to hear their experiences.

Other treatments include cognitive behavioral therapy, interpersonal psychotherapy and family psychotherapy. CBT and IPT teach people how to alter their patterns of thinking, behavior and relationships. They can help people learn how they can manage stress and enhance their resilience skills. Family therapy is an excellent way to work with loved ones to resolve issues and build healthy relationships.

Some people are suffering from severe mental problems that they require treatment in a residential treatment program or a hospital. This kind of treatment is temporary and designed to stabilize the patient. This can be an option for those who are suicidal or in danger of harming themselves.

New technologies are transforming the way mental health services are delivered. Mobile apps and other technological tools can help therapists deliver effective treatments which would be difficult or even impossible to offer in a traditional setting. For instance, Quenza is an app that allows therapists to record a variety of mental health-related activities and distribute them to their clients on a schedule. These exercises measure the intensity of feelings throughout the week and can be discussed in an in-person session later on.

Cost

Online mental health assessments can be a fantastic method to evaluate a child's problems without the need for a face-toface visit. These assessments are fast and free. They are also accessible anytime of the day and can be accessed from any location. A full clinical psychological assessment can be very expensive and time-consuming. Self-assessments online for psychological health like Healios e-PASS*, are speedier and cheaper than traditional face-to-face assessments.

A thorough psychiatric examination usually includes a physical exam, an interview with the patient and family members, and a discussion of their symptoms. The evaluation also includes a review of the patient's medical history and medications. It is crucial to answer all questions honestly and accurately in order to ensure a correct diagnosis is made. A psychiatrist can diagnose based on symptoms, but it is crucial to consider other factors, such as lifestyle or environment.

Numerous studies have demonstrated that online interventions can be cost-effective for treating mental disorders (Baumann, Donker, and Ophuis 2017). However the studies have restricted their economic analyses to a societal perspective and did not differentiate between the costs of the system and those of the patient. This knowledge gap limits the capacity of policymakers to provide information about the cost-effectiveness of digital interventions in mental health.

Even though many online mental health assessments are beneficial but users must be cautious when using them. Some tests that seem fun may be clever ruses to collect personal information like passwords. These data can then be sold to marketers or even used to guess the passwords of individuals. Therefore, it is essential to only use trusted websites and carefully read their privacy policies.

A growing number of telepsychiatry providers offer affordable, convenient care. Some offer reduced rates for subsequent visits, while other offer a discounted price for patients with insurance. On their websites, many Telepsychiatry providers have a list of insurance plans they accept. If your insurance plan does not cover telepsychiatry, you can look into alternative payment options like the HSA or FSA.
